To make such a character I might look at the Technical Department of Moonbase Alpha and among those in that group, I would look to the research scientists having expected to stand firm and reach out with their senses through their equipment to a universe forever out of reach now find themselves grounded on a tree of discovery which has been uprooted around them and cast beyond the range of their once Earthbound eyes.

As noted above, we can start with a loose concept of Research Scientist as we leap into chargen. That puts us, at least at the start of things on Alpha, with the Technical Department which is divided between maintenance and research. After following the muse of Hunger with a hint of emotion and a dash of Thursday, I arranged the character to be a little rough around the edges socially, good at their work, and focused on the opportunities to expand human knowledge that a free-falling Alpha provides. You can take a look at it below. I have chosen a gender-obscuring name, so if you choose to use the character in your own games, it’s up to you.
Sam was primarily tied to Nuclear Science and has a good grounding in the technical aspects of Alpha’s nuclear plant, but is more interested in Physics research – particularly after Breakaway. As a result of this disposition and background, Sam has access to a private lab and is generally trusted to work to the benefit of the base. Currently, Sam is studying the motion of Luna and hoping to develop an understanding suitable for developing better propulsion systems… perhaps much better.
Characters made for 2D20 are quite simple to make and with some exposure, easy to read at a glance. Sam is not going to be getting into fights, but at the same time is not going to be getting in the way, either.
